The Center for Digestive Health focuses on disorders related to the digestive system, including both short-term conditions and chronic, lifelong diseases. These conditions may involve the liver, stomach, colon, small intestine, gallbladder, or pancreas. State of the art diagnostic techniques are utilized in our Endoscopy Center and at affiliated hospitals. Outpatient care is delivered in our clinical center and infusion center, and our doctors provide 24 hour/7 day a week coverage to our affiliated hospitals. The Center for Digestive Health participates in Medicare and every major managed health care plan in Orange, Seminole, Osceola and Lake counties.

Automated Patient Appointment Scheduling and Reminders

Medical practices manage high volumes of appointment requests and the critical need for patient attendance. AI agents can streamline booking processes, reduce no-shows through intelligent reminders, and optimize provider schedules, ensuring efficient patient flow and resource utilization.

10-20% reduction in no-show ratesIndustry Benchmarks for Healthcare Practice Management
An AI agent that interfaces with patients via phone or text to book, reschedule, or cancel appointments. It can also send automated, personalized appointment reminders and follow-ups, reducing manual administrative burden and improving patient adherence.

AI-Powered Medical Scribe for Clinical Documentation

Physician burnout is a significant challenge, often exacerbated by extensive documentation requirements. AI agents can capture and transcribe patient-physician conversations in real-time, populating electronic health records (EHRs) with accurate, structured notes, freeing up clinician time for patient care.

20-30% time savings per physician for documentationMedical Journal of AI in Healthcare
This AI agent listens to patient encounters, identifies key medical information, and generates concise, accurate clinical notes. It integrates with EHR systems, pre-filling relevant fields and reducing the need for manual data entry by clinicians.

Intelligent Prior Authorization Processing

The prior authorization process is a notorious bottleneck in healthcare, causing delays in patient treatment and significant administrative overhead. AI agents can automate the submission and tracking of authorization requests, improving turnaround times and reducing claim denials.

30-50% faster authorization processingHealthcare Administrative Efficiency Studies
An AI agent that extracts necessary patient and procedure information from EHRs, completes prior authorization forms, submits them to payers, and tracks their status. It can flag issues and alert staff to required follow-ups.

Automated Medical Billing and Coding Support

Accurate medical billing and coding are essential for practice revenue. Errors can lead to claim rejections and delayed payments. AI agents can analyze clinical documentation to suggest appropriate medical codes, identify potential billing errors, and streamline the revenue cycle.

5-10% reduction in coding errors, 15-25% faster claim processingAmerican Academy of Professional Coders (AAPC) Reports
This AI agent reviews clinical notes and patient records to recommend ICD-10 and CPT codes, ensuring compliance and accuracy. It can also flag claims for potential review before submission, reducing denials and improving cash flow.

How do AI agents ensure patient data privacy and HIPAA compliance?
Reputable AI solutions are designed with robust security protocols and adhere strictly to HIPAA regulations. They employ data encryption, access controls, and audit trails to protect sensitive patient information. Compliance is typically managed through secure cloud infrastructure and vendor agreements that guarantee data privacy standards are met.

What data and integration requirements are needed for AI agents?
AI agents typically require integration with existing practice management systems (PMS) and electronic health records (EHR). Access to structured data such as patient demographics, appointment schedules, and billing information is crucial for effective operation. Secure API connections or data feeds are common integration methods.
